Variables Affecting the Expense of Oral Implants



When budgeting for oral implants, you must take into consideration different elements that can affect the price.

One vital factor is the number of implants you require. The more implants called for, the greater the cost will be.

Additionally, the type of dental implant utilized can also impact the cost. There are various materials and brand names readily available, each with its own rate range.

One more factor to take into consideration is the location of the dental center. Costs can differ depending on the location you live in.

Furthermore, the intricacy of your situation can likewise influence the cost. If extra treatments, such as bone grafting or sinus lifts, are needed, the total cost will likely increase.

The Refine of Getting Dental Implants: What to Expect



To understand the process of getting dental implants, you need to understand what to expect throughout the treatment. Here are three vital things to keep in mind:

1. Initial Examination: Your dental expert will certainly examine your mouth and take X-rays to assess your oral health and wellness and determine if you're an appropriate candidate for dental implants. This action is critical to guarantee the success of the implant treatment.

2. Surgical Placement: The dental implant surgical procedure involves placing a titanium post right into your jawbone. This serves as the foundation for the replacement tooth. While the treatment is normally done under local anesthesia, you might experience some discomfort and swelling afterward.

3. Recovery and Repair: After the implant is placed, a healing duration of a couple of months is needed for the dental implant to fuse with the jawbone. When recovered, your dental practitioner will certainly attach an abutment and a personalized crown, providing you a natural-looking and useful replacement tooth.

Tips for Budgeting for Dental Implants



If you're taking into consideration dental implants, it is very important to strategy and budget for the prices involved. Right here are some suggestions to help you with budgeting for dental implants.

First, study different dental implant providers and compare their costs. Costs can vary significantly, so it's important to shop around and discover a supplier that supplies a fair and reasonable price.

Additionally, take into consideration discovering dental insurance coverage choices that may cover some or every one of the implant expenditures. Some insurance coverage plans may have waiting periods or specific insurance coverage limitations, so make sure to check out the small print.

One more pointer is to talk about payment plans with your oral supplier. Several service providers provide versatile payment alternatives, which can assist you manage the expense of your oral implants with time.

Finally, consider establishing a dedicated savings account particularly for your oral implant costs. By setting aside money each month, you can slowly save up for the treatment and reduce the financial burden.
